The Brits Lead the Glamorous at the Critics' Choice Awards...

Last night at the Critic's Choice Awards the British led the line up of glamorous gowns. I have such a soft spot for gowns and so the awards season for me is my favourite time of the year!

Emily Blunt looked incredible in a red Emilio Pucci gown. I love all of the embellishment and if that wasn't enough she added diamond bangles to add even more sparkle to the ensemble.

Rosamund Pike, who gave birth just 5 weeks ago, wowed in a Valentino gown that had a touch of a bridal look to it.

Felicity Jones was a complete comparison in a more gothic style gown by Dolce and Gabbana, but still looked incredible.

Kiera Knightly, who is currently pregnant, wore a floaty gown by Delpozo which brushed over her baby bump in masses of pale grey chiffon.

Although the Brits were well represented in some fabulous outfits, there were also some looks that I loved.

Angelina Jolie was arguably the best dressed there in a metallic Versace gown that draped in gorgeous shimmering waves. I love Angelina Jolie's style and this was not a disappointment.

Leslie Mann and Amy Adams opted for midi dresses in metallic hues, which looked equally amazing and made a nice change from all the gowns.

Jennifer Aniston opted for a fitted trouser suit, and no top!, which looked really good on her. It's nice to see people trying something different on the red carpet.

72nd Annual Golden Globes

One of the best things about the new year is that it means that it is the beginning of the awards season and for us the beginning of the gowns season!

The first event of the year was the 72nd Golden Globes which were held at the Beverley Hills Hotel.

There were some fabulous outfits and also some not-so-fabulous outfits. I am join to start with my personal favourite - Amal Clooney. She has been making fashion headlines since she married George Clooney last September.

Amal looked amazing in Vintage Dior and Harry Winston diamonds. I loved the vintage hollywood look.
